The Brit Awards, sandwiched between the Grammys and the Junos, are Great Britain's celebration of the past year in music.
While there are some British artists little-known to music fans on this side of the pond, most of the attendees have made a big splash here, from breakouts like One Direction, Ellie Golding and Jessie J to retro stars like Kylie Minogue and Boy George to hipster faves like Katie B, Laura Mvula and Arctic Monkeys.
Plus, plenty of international guests take trans-Atlantic flights to the party, too, like Katy Perry, Bruno Mars and Pharell as well as America's queen Beyonce and prince, er, Prince.
The winners go to a mix of British and international acts, as well, which led to both David Bowie and Lorde amazingly picking up Brits despite their 50 year age difference. The full Brits' winners list is below the slideshow.
British Group: Arctic Monkeys
British Female Solo Artist: Ellie Goulding
International Male Solo Artist: Bruno Mars
British Breakthrough Act: Bastille
British Male Solo Artist: David Bowie
Critics' Choice: Sam Smith
British Single: Rudimental Feat. Ella Eyre - 'Waiting All Night'
International Female Solo Artist: Lorde
International Group: Daft Punk
British Video: One Direction - 'Best Song Ever'
British Album Of The Year: Arctic Monkeys
